Các version/phiên bản và tính năng của ngôn ngữ lập trình C#

C# 7.0 released with VS2017 (March 2017) Major new features: tuples, ref locals and ref return, pattern matching (including pattern-based switch statements), inline out parameter declarations, local functions, binary literals, digit separators, and arbitrary async returns.